Historical Roots and Cultural Significance

Paithani traces its origins to the ancient city of Paithan in Maharashtra, India. Its rich history dates back over 2,000 years, with evidence suggesting its existence during the Satavahana dynasty (230 BCE - 220 CE). The fabric's name, "Paithani," is derived from the city of its origin and bears witness to its historical and cultural roots.

Over the centuries, paithani has adorned the wardrobes of royalty, maharajas, and noblewomen. It has been used to create exquisite saris, kurtas, and lehengas, each a masterpiece of textile art. Today, paithani continues to be a prized possession, treasured for its historical significance and aesthetic appeal.

Intricate Craftsmanship: A Labor of Love

Handcrafted with meticulous care, paithani lehenga material is a testament to the skill and dedication of Indian artisans. The intricate motifs are created using a unique double ikat weaving technique, where both the warp and weft threads are dyed before weaving. This complex process requires exceptional precision and can take weeks or even months to complete.

Each paithani motif is symbolic and holds cultural significance. Common motifs include peacocks, elephants, and geometric patterns, each representing prosperity, royalty, or good fortune. The vibrant colors, ranging from deep reds to emerald greens and golden yellows, add to the allure of the fabric, making it a captivating visual spectacle.

The Price of Opulence: A Valuable Investment

The exquisite craftsmanship and intricate designs of paithani lehenga material come at a premium. A genuine paithani lehenga can cost anywhere from $500 to $10,000, depending on the complexity of the design, the quality of the silk, and the reputation of the weaver.

Story 2: Paithani's Revival

In the mid-20th century, the paithani industry faced a decline due to changing fashion trends and the introduction of synthetic fabrics. However, a group of dedicated artisans and textile enthusiasts worked tirelessly to revive the art form. Today, paithani is once again a thriving industry, with weavers preserving and promoting this ancient craft.

Caring for Your Paithani Lehenga: A Delicate Treasure

Due to its intricate craftsmanship and delicate silk fabric, caring for a paithani lehenga requires special attention. Here are some tips for preserving its beauty:

  • Dry clean only. Avoid washing or bleaching your paithani lehenga.
  • Store in a cool, dry place away from direct sunlight.
  • Use a muslin cloth or acid-free tissue paper to wrap your lehenga for storage.
  • Avoid folding the lehenga multiple times, as this can create creases.
  • If any repairs are needed, seek the services of a skilled artisan who specializes in paithani restoration.
